NICOLAS CHOUZOURIS With his wife, children and grandchildren by his side, Nicolas Chouzouris left us on his journey to meet the Lord. Nicolas was born August 15, 1926 in Chios, Greece. He immigrated to Winnipeg in 1974 with his wife and two sons, Demetri and Dino. He worked for many years in the restaurant business - at Juniors and at Acropolis restaurant, along with his brother Emmanuel. Dad was a long standing member of the St. Demetrios Greek Orthodox Church. Nicolas is survived by his loving wife of 56 years, Elli; sons, Demetri (Athena) and Dino (Georgia); and grandchildren, Ellie, Chrissoula and Valandi. Prayers will be held Wednesday, April 29 at 7:00 p.m. at the St. Demetrios Greek Orthodox Church, 2255 Grant Ave. Funeral service will take place at the same location on Thursday, April 30 at 11:00 a.m. with Rev. Fr. Konstantinos Tsiolas officiating. Interment will follow at Waverley Memorial Gardens.
